Two Sides of the Heart: Part 1

461 13 1
By SimWoman2002

Summary: When Kate, Natasha, Yelena, and Clint go on a mission together, things go horribly wrong, and Natasha ends up being forced to make a choice that she may never entirely forgive herself for having to make despite how necessary it may have been.


   "Hey, look, I'm like that guy off Star Wars with how slick I am," Kate declared, extremely pleased with herself and how she had just now managed to so efficiently land her shot into the padlock's keyhole with the key-forger arrow. Yelena rolled her eyes, but Natasha seemed pleased with Kate's handiwork.

Kate, Natasha, Yelena, and Clint had all gone on a mission together to bust a super soldier scientist for Hydra that had been experimenting with mixing nuclear, radioactive material and some form of the super soldier serum together to make a new brand of dangerous, mutant warriors.

Fortunately, he was reported to be relatively harmless because he had no real fighting experience. But the odd part of the entire thing was that he seemed to be working in extreme secrecy underground with minimum security. Kate had thought that maybe they figured he would be hidden, and he would be safe.

However, Yelena and Natasha believed that the minimum security must be their best guys or that he might be more dangerous than they thought.

"You're going to have to be more specific," Yelena told her, pulling her from her thoughts, and Kate huffed. Natasha simply raised an eyebrow at the both of them as they started into the building carefully.

"You know!! The guy! I've never watched it, but he looked slick!" Kate tried to tell her, making her voice a little quieter as they walked in, and Yelena just huffed from where she was walking on the opposite side of Natasha from Kate.

"You mean the wookie?" Clint questioned over the commlink, his voice sounding way too amused. Kate huffed, actually having just enough knowledge of Star Wars to remember that the wookie was that thing that looked like an overgrown Yorkshire Terrier.

"No! The man! He's played by that actor! Old what's-his-name!" Kate tried to jog her memory. Yelena's eyes suddenly went wide as she took in a sharp breath.

"Oh!"

"You remember him?!" Kate excitedly questioned, and Yelena nodded quickly.

"Yeah, it was Yoda! Oh, wow, I do see the resemblance," Yelena pointed out as she gestured to Kate's face with a huge smirk. Kate let out a deep sigh, knowing now that she definitely was not going to get the answer out of Yelena. Clint laughed heartily in her ear, and Kate knew she was not getting the answer out of him either.

"Tasha, what's his name?"

"I didn't watch it," Natasha shrugged, looking apologetic, and Kate let out a deep sigh.

"You did watch it, you stinky poser. You just fell asleep when it started," Yelena accused, and Natasha just huffed, rolling her eyes fondly before directing her attentions to Clint on the other end of the line.

"Barton, you picking up any signals of the radioactive material?" Natasha questioned, and Clint let out a sigh that was surprisingly crackly sounding. Kate immediately knew the connection was getting worse.

"No, and the further you guys get in there, the harder it is to hear— must— diffusor—"

Clint's voice suddenly blipped out, and Natasha let out a sigh as she looked at the other two. Yelena nodded slowly.

"There must be a signal diffusor killing outside communications," Yelena stated, and Natasha nodded, glancing briefly in Kate's direction.

"Meaning that they've been expecting us," Natasha explained, and Kate swallowed, furrowing her brow as she withdrew her bow and held it in her grasp as she tapped her fingers along it gently.

"Okay... Maximum stealth from this point onward. Keep your head on a swivel and don't let them get the drop on you. I'll take point, and you bring up the rear," Natasha said as she pointed at Yelena. Yelena nodded, and they started to head through the building.

They remarkably did not run across anyone as they reached an elevator, and Natasha furrowed her brow as she looked around suddenly.

"There's no one here in this building," Natasha pointed out, and Yelena looked at her oddly, tilting her head.

"The guy's not here?"

"Not necessarily. I've dealt with something like this in the past. They've pulled this same trick before. No security in sight and the guy we're after at the bottom. As soon as we got to the guy, security came in to storm us from where they were hiding in these cell-like rooms near the bottom floor," Natasha told the both of them, and Kate remained quiet as Yelena spoke up again.

"So split up and close up the rooms? Everything here except the outside door has had a metal door that seems to be opened from a main controls room, so they probably won't be able to break out if somebody circles around and closes them up," Yelena stated, and Natasha nodded easily. Kate knew that most of their additional explanations were for her benefit to tell her what they were doing and explain the logic behind it.

"Yeah... That's probably the best idea," Natasha agreed, and Yelena hummed in acknowledgement.

"So Kate can go find the control rooms and me and you go down to start finding our guy?" Yelena questioned, and Natasha shook her head. Kate tried to resist letting out a breath of relief. She honestly did not particularly relish the idea of having to go through this creepy, cold building alone despite the fact that she would have willingly done it for the good of the mission.

"No... Little one, you take care of the control rooms. Me and Kate are going to head down," Natasha explained, and Kate felt a sense of happiness and relief overcoming her with Natasha's words.

"What? Why? Me and you are way better equipped to handle him and any surprises," Yelena disagreed, and Natasha shook her head as she looked at her.

"But if I'm wrong about the security and they're just in a different part of the building, we'll be sending Kate into their midst, and she's not ready," Natasha argued, and Kate felt rather awkward having to listen to their conversation about her right in front of her.

Yelena stared at her for a long time before finally letting out a sigh, looking away. Natasha stepped closer to her, placing her hand on the side of her face.

"Look at me," Natasha spoke, and Yelena finally met her eyes, looking rather unhappy.

"We'll be fine. Besides, I know you can get the job done fast because you have the experience," Natasha assured her. Yelena nodded a little and Natasha kissed her nose briefly before pulling away and moving into the elevator. Kate followed her quickly, and they both watched as the doors shut and Yelena headed off to go and find the control rooms.

"So... Are we going straight to the bottom?" Kate asked, and Natasha moved forward to hit the button to take them to the bottom floor.

"In my experience, that seems to be the best place to start," Natasha answered, and Kate nodded briefly, feeling nervousness coming over her and a need to fill the silence overcoming her as well.

"So do the commlinks that are inside the building connect with each other or does the diffusor thingy shut down all communications?" Kate asked curiously, and suddenly Yelena's voice came into her ear.

"Yeah, and it'd be really nice if you'd turn yours off until you're ready to say something important so I don't have to hear you breathing and asking stupid questions," Yelena told her, and Kate narrowed her eyes a little, getting the answer to her question. Kate, however, did not bother turning off her commlink.

"Hey, it might be good to keep up an open line of communication so we don't have to waste time clicking it on and off if we get in a rough spot," Natasha explained, and Yelena groaned. However, as her breaths continued to resound in Kate's ears, she knew she had left it on as Natasha asked her to.

Before long, they reached the bottom, and Natasha withdrew her gun. Kate readied her bow, and the doors of the elevator opened carefully. To their surprise, there was not a single enemy in sight, and the room was empty. Natasha shared a brief glance with Kate, and they tentatively started into the room, looking all around as they remained ready for a potential attack.

"I've accessed the control room and shut all rooms down except two escape routes leading to your floor. I see him down there, but I can't get a good idea of where he," Yelena suddenly stopped, going dead silent. Natasha immediately paused for a moment, her attentions on the commlink.

"Yelena? You there?" Natasha questioned worriedly.

"Yeah, it's just... The cameras went out. The doors are still locked down, though. Be careful," Yelena answered, sounding a little on edge. Suddenly, Kate caught movement out of the corner of her eye and she turned her head quickly. To her shock, the scientist was standing there with a large machine gun, and Kate's eyes went wide as she realized it was aimed directly at Natasha.

"TASHA!!!" Kate cried, jumping forward and colliding heavily with Natasha's body. Natasha hit the ground immediately, Kate's weight firmly on top of her as they landed behind a nearby bulk of sturdy-looking metal.

"What's happening?! Natashka?! Kate Bishop, you'd better answer me right now!!!" Yelena demanded, her voice positively panicked, and Kate swiftly rolled off of Natasha as they both got their bearings. Natasha backed up so that she was directly against cover. Kate swiftly accompanied her, making sure she was ducked down below it as the bullets flew.

"Sweet girl, we're fine... Kate saved me," Natasha assured her, and Yelena let out an audible breath of relief that resounded through the commlink. Kate let out a breath as she flinched a little as a particularly close bullet whizzed by her ear.

She withdrew further into the cover, and Natasha furrowed her brow as she attempted to take a look to try to gauge the gunner's position. Kate followed her example, but as soon as she managed to get a glimpse of him, he started shooting again, and Natasha yanked her back down.

"We've got a problem. Yelena, see if you can get behind this guy. We've got him distracted at the front, and we're going to try to hit him, but if you get an opening, take it," Natasha explained quickly.

"Don't worry, I'm already almost at your position now," Yelena acknowledged, her breath coming in pants, and Kate quickly realized the older woman must have been sprinting at full-speed when she heard Kate yelling about Natasha.

She was quickly distracted by another set of bullets flashing by her, and Kate swallowed hard, grasping her bow as she held onto it tightly to ground herself. She had never been shot at quite this much before, and the steady onslaught of bullets was starting to unnerve her. She could not help the feeling that she was about to be hit by one of them.

"Hey, hey, calm down," Natasha spoke softly, interrupting Kate in her terror-filled thoughts as she reached out to squeeze her arm.

"We've got this, okay? You're doing beautifully, and you saved me. It's okay," Natasha assured as more bullets whizzed far too close to the top of her head. Natasha ducked down a little further but kept her light greens locked onto Kate's as she attempted to reassure her. Kate nodded quickly, swallowing hard.

"Now this guy is going to reload in a second, and if you can shoot one of your explosive arrows at him, that should take care of him," Natasha told her, her voice calm and reassuring as always. Kate nodded with a swallow as she reached into her quiver and withdrew one of the arrows in question to prepare herself. Natasha smiled slightly in wordless approval.

"Okay... He should be having to reload any minute now. I've been tracking the time," Natasha told her, and Kate just remained quiet, trying to wait until the firing died down. As soon as it grew quiet, Kate knew it was the time to act.

Kate swiftly shot up, aiming her arrow at the man and setting it loose. It quickly collided with him and blew up in a considerable explosion that knocked him over and against the wall. Natasha quickly raised up alongside her to look at the situation and at that moment, Yelena came rushing in on the other side of the room.

Once there was a moment of silence and it seemed that the guy was not getting up, Natasha let out a breath of relief next to Kate, and Kate could not help a slightly nervous chuckle as she relaxed and put her bow over her shoulder.

"Amazing job, shchenok," Natasha praised, her voice full of nothing but the most warmth as she reached over and squeezed the back of Kate's neck softly yet firmly. Kate beamed under her compliment, and they both stood up as they started to head for the center of the room. Yelena was already running over, and Natasha opened her arms for her to receive her quickly. Yelena instantly crashed into them as soon as she was close enough, and Natasha stroked the back of her head.

After a long moment, Yelena released her, and her gaze fell upon Kate. Kate just looked at Yelena somewhat uncertainly, not sure what the blonde was about to do. Yelena reached out hesitantly to squeeze Kate's shoulder.

"Thank you," Yelena expressed, and Kate smiled a little, shrugging easily and nonchalantly despite the huge swell of pride and happiness washing through her at the older woman's approval.

"Nah, it wasn't that big of a deal. I mean... It was cool, but like... she would've done the same for me," Kate attempted to downplay it a little despite her admittance that she felt it was rather cool. She was fighting between her instincts to tone down her own achievements and her desire to revel in the monumental victory she just had.

"Well, yeah, but that's because she majorly gets off on self-sacrificial BS," Yelena informed her, and Kate just grinned widely as she caught Natasha's displeased wrinkle of her nose.

"Do you seriously have to put it that way?" Natasha asked, and Yelena smirked with a far too large, self-satisfied smile as she gravitated nearer to the redhead.

"But seriously, Katie-Bear. Thank you," Yelena expressed, her arm wrapping around Natasha. Natasha looked at her with a smile, and Yelena glanced between her and Kate, offering Natasha an especially soft and adoring look. Kate narrowed her eyes a little at the use of the nickname, still having to say something in opposition to it as was so customary of her.

"Don't call me Katie. And hey, super soldiers are apparently not always that super. I mean... I knocked that one out cold. Oh, gosh, I can't wait to tell Clint about this!" Kate could not help but note excitedly as she felt the thrill filling her at the thought that entered her mind suddenly. She wanted more than anything to see that proud look on his face that he so occasionally offered her.

"Look, super soldiers aren't easy to knock out. But I guess this one was especially arrogant and stupid for staying in one place for too long and made it a little easy for you," Yelena pointed out, and Natasha rolled her eyes affectionately as she ruffled Yelena's hair playfully.

"C'mon, you two. Let's bag this guy before he comes to, okay?" Natasha told them.

It was almost like her words had flipped a switch, and it was like everything went in slow motion as Kate suddenly felt a bullet crash into the right side of her chest and another hit her in the leg. Her eyes went wide and she fell backwards, crashing on the ground as she took in the scene unfolding in front of her.

Yelena turned quickly toward the source of the bullets, and she moved herself in front of Natasha, pulling them both to the ground. Natasha threw out several grenades and shocked them with her widow's bites. They exploded in quick succession around the super soldier, and when they finished going off, Kate was almost sure that he was not entirely in one piece anymore.

She let her head fall back against the pavement as she grasped at her chest with a hand, trying to keep the hole pulled together as she gasped for breath and tried to remain as still as possible to keep the bleeding from speeding up too much.

This was most certainly not how this mission was supposed to go at all.

After a few moments that felt like agonizing hours, she was finally met with Natasha rushing over to look her over, her hands touching Kate's face softly as she grasped her. She almost had tears in her eyes, and Kate had never really seen her quite this freaked out before.

"Hey, hey, you okay?! Where all did you get hit?" Natasha questioned, her voice urgent in a way Kate had never heard from her. She sounded one shade away from completely panicking, and Kate swallowed hard.

"'M fine, just my chest and my leg," Kate admitted, and Natasha swiftly looked down at her leg as she took in the sight of it. Kate gritted her teeth as Natasha placed her hands around her leg.

However, Natasha finally just shook her head and took her hand connected to the arm on her good side as she pulled her upright. She carefully grabbed at her, and Kate whimpered in spite of herself as Natasha pulled her over so that she was sitting upright against a nearby crate.

Once Natasha had ensured she was sitting straight up, she rushed back over to Yelena, and Kate quickly understood precisely why Natasha was so freaked out.

Yelena was lying there on the floor, completely unconscious with what looked to be two or three holes in her. Natasha was almost freaking out totally as her hands shook like a leaf and her eyes were ridiculously wide in utter horror.

"Sweet girl, detka... Come on, wake up, we've got to get up and get out of here," Natasha spoke to her swiftly, and Kate took shallow breaths, trying to keep from causing herself to cough. The bullet had truly hit in a terribly inconvenient place.

"Kate, can you walk?" Natasha questioned, and Kate swallowed as she tried to pull herself to her feet. As soon as she put weight on her leg, it gave out from underneath her, pain exploding. Kate yelped in spite of herself, and she bit the inside of her cheek hard as she attempted and failed to keep the noise down. Natasha moved toward her quickly, helping her sit back down.

Natasha was looking frantically between the both of them, and Kate could see the conflict on her face.

The fact of it was that Yelena was in far worse shape than Kate, and while Kate was actively bleeding out, Yelena was in a horrible state and was even knocked out. Kate knew Natasha knew this, and she also knew that given both her and Yelena's condition, they would not be able to walk.

And given Natasha's abilities, the redhead would only be able to support or carry one of them at a time. Which in Yelena's case could mean the difference between life or death depending on what she chose.

If only there was not a signal disruptor on the building that kept them from communicating with Clint on the outside.

"Tasha, take her," Kate commanded gently, and Natasha immediately snapped her gaze to Kate, looking positively horrified.

"What?! No, Kate, I'm not leaving you," Natasha determinedly informed her, and Kate let out a shaking breath, her head undeniably growing a little light.

"Tasha, you know that if you don't take her, she's going to die," Kate stated it far more bluntly than she meant to, and Natasha looked sick to her stomach. Kate immediately regretted it, but she knew it was the truth. Natasha knew it, too.

"But what if I'm not able to get back to you in time?" Natasha questioned, her voice breaking a little as her gaze looked positively torn. Kate shook her head, looking between Yelena's fallen form and Natasha's light greens that were boring holes into her own eyes right now.

"It's a chance we have to take. Now take her," Kate insisted, and Natasha shook her head, starting to say something in opposition to Kate's words.

"Just go! Please," Kate told her, raising her voice just a little as she tried to get it through to Natasha. Natasha blinked for just a moment before giving Kate the most pained, agonized look she had ever seen on any being. Natasha leaned forward quickly, kissing her forehead firmly before pulling back.

"I love you. Stay alive, angel. I'm coming back for you," Natasha expressed before running over to Yelena and grabbing her in her arms, lifting her up as she carried her out quickly.

Kate let out a breath, closing her eyes as she tried to ward away the pain that was growing exponentially by the second.

The last thing she could think of as she lost all senses of consciousness was that she really wished she could remember what that actor's name was.
